Big news from France! Their new Archange bizjet has flown for the first time. The ISR/EW platform is based on the Dassault Aviation Falcon 8X and is equipped with the Thales CUGE sensor suite.

Factory Friday 🏭 This is Bally Ribbon Mills in Bally, PA Founded in 1923, Bally designs & manufactures engineered woven webbing, tapes & specialty narrow fabrics from shuttle & jacquard looms to 2‑D/3‑D structures ISO 9001:2015, AS9100D & ISO 13485 certified 🇺🇸
